Frequently Asked Questions

Are Concrete Floors Cold and Damp? yes, but no more so than ceramic tile or natural stone flooring. The reality: • Concrete doesn't have to be cold. Its thermal properties give it the ability to store and radiate heat. By embedding radiant heating cables in concrete floors, for example, you can keep floors toasty warm in the winter and you can control the temperature level. • In properly constructed newer homes, today's building codes typically require installation of a vapor barrier under concrete slabs to block moisture migration and that feeling of dampness (see Choosing a Vapor Barrier). • If the home is built to take advantage of solar radiation entering through windows, concrete floors will absorb the heat from the sun to keep rooms warmer in the winter. • In summer and in hot climates, a cooler floor can be an advantage and can actually help lower air-conditioning costs. Is Polished Concrete Slippery? Because of polished concrete’s unique shine and slick appearance, many people question if it is a slippery surface. When the concrete is clean and dry, it is generally no more slippery than plain concrete surfaces. In fact, polished concrete tends to be less slippery than waxed linoleum or polished marble
